Peanut Butter Cookies

Deliciously soft and chewy peanut butter cookies made with simple ingredients, perfect for a classic homemade treat.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up peanut butter (creamy or crunchy)
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ine peanut butter, sugar, egg, vanilla extract, baking soda, and salt.
  3. Mix until all ingredients are fully incorporated and a dough forms.
  4. Roll the dough into 1-inch balls and place them 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heet.
  5. Flatten each ball gently with a fork, creating a crisscross pattern.
  6. Bake for 10 to 12 minutes, or until the cookies are golden around the edges.
  7. Remove from the oven and allow cookies to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

For extra richness, try adding a pinch of cinnamon or dipping half of each cookie in melted chocolate once cooled.
